促进幼儿期的社会、情感和认知发展:一项针对支持最佳育儿实践的文化适应性数字工具进行早期评估的方案。

Promoting social, emotional, and cognitive development in early childhood: A protocol for early valuation of a culturally adapted digital tool for supporting optimal childrearing practices.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E

The Thrive by Five app promotes positive interactions between children and parents, extended family, and trusted community members that support optimal socio-emotional and cognitive development in the early years. This article aims to describe the protocol for a prospective mixed-methods multi-site study evaluating Thrive by Five using surveys, interviews, workshops, audio diaries from citizen ethnographers and app usage data.

METHODS

The study activities and timelines differ by site, with an extensive longitudinal evaluation being conducted at two sites and a basic evaluation being conducted at five sites. The learnings from the more comprehensive evaluations inform the iterative research and development processes while also ensuring ongoing evaluation of usability, acceptability and effectiveness of the app and its content across varying contexts. The study evaluates: (1) the impact of the Thrive by Five content on caregiver knowledge, behaviours, attitudes and confidence; (2) how the content changes relationships at the familial, community and system level; (3) how cultural and contextual factors influence content engagement and effectiveness and (4) the processes that facilitate or disrupt the success of the implementation and dissemination.

RESULTS

All in-country partners have been identified and data collection has been completed in Indonesia, Malaysia, Afghanistan, Kyrgyzstan, Uzbekistan, Namibia and Cameroon.

CONCLUSIONS

Very few digital health solutions have been trialled for usability and effectiveness in diverse cultural contexts. By combining quantitative, qualitative, process and ethnographic methodologies, this innovative study informs the iterative and ongoing optimisation of the cultural and contextual sensitivity of the Thrive by Five content and the processes supporting implementation and dissemination.

摘要

目标

“五岁茁壮成长”应用程序促进儿童与父母、大家庭以及支持早期最佳社会情感和认知发展的可信赖社区成员之间的积极互动。本文旨在描述一项前瞻性混合方法多地点研究的方案,该研究使用调查、访谈、工作坊、公民人种志学者的音频日记以及应用程序使用数据来评估“五岁茁壮成长”。

方法

各地点的研究活动和时间表有所不同,在两个地点进行广泛的纵向评估,在五个地点进行基础评估。更全面评估的结果为迭代研究和开发过程提供信息,同时确保在不同背景下持续评估应用程序及其内容的可用性、可接受性和有效性。该研究评估:(1)“五岁茁壮成长”内容对照顾者知识、行为、态度和信心产生的影响;(2)该内容如何在家庭、社区和系统层面改变人际关系;(3)文化和背景因素如何影响内容参与度和有效性;以及(4)促进或阻碍实施和传播成功的过程。

结果

所有国内合作伙伴均已确定,印度尼西亚、马来西亚、阿富汗、吉尔吉斯斯坦、乌兹别克斯坦、纳米比亚和喀麦隆的数据收集工作已经完成。

结论

很少有数字健康解决方案在不同文化背景下进行可用性和有效性试验。通过结合定量、定性、过程和人种志方法,这项创新性研究为“五岁茁壮成长”内容的文化和背景敏感性以及支持实施和传播的过程的迭代和持续优化提供了信息。
